Transaction b375ec15a0363712453cddda05770eea35929a2453b6c7cd90caee49cc02b757

1 Input
2 Outputs
  • b375ec15a0363712453cddda05770eea35929a2453b6c7cd90caee49cc02b757:0
  • value  960963089
    address  3DdfiW6yv4Pq5VvqCDKyGJcLH11EGMiqS3
  • b375ec15a0363712453cddda05770eea35929a2453b6c7cd90caee49cc02b757:1
  • value  14950000
    address  3GHqBuVYoHhBhndsvVnZUKRRCdXbA3opQK